Last year, the refrigerator in the Bosch brand white goods set I bought for my dowry started to appear yellowish colors on both door surfaces of the refrigerator, even though it was not exposed to any chemicals and was used recently. The service said that this intense defect was "user error and maybe the refrigerator doors can be changed once". If it was my own fault, instead of dotted stains, there would be wiping stains that occurred after being wiped with chemicals. I did not buy this product second-hand, so only the covers will be changed? It was obvious that a defective product was sold. And it is not clear whether I will be able to find a contact person for the incompatibility that will occur on the covers after the new covers are installed. I demand that my product be replaced with a new one instead of the cover replacement. Otherwise, I would like to state that I will go to Consumer Rights.
